I bought my Grandson a MP-15 22LR back in the early summer. And he loves it! BUT! he's wanting to put a aftermarket Buttstock on it, I don't have it at my house or I could probably figure it out? Is the recoil spring tube the same size as a reg AR-15? He wants some sort of Magpul Buttstock? Or does it have to be a specific one for his MP15-22?

will any aftermarket buttstock fit it with NO modification's?

THANKS in advance for any Help or Info!

Yes, aftermarket butt stocks work, however, make sure you get a MIL SPEC butt stock, not a commercial butt stock. The buffer tube is a MIL SPEC size tube.

The 15-22 can accept MANY items made specifically for their big brother:

Trigger/Hammer
Butt Stocks
Optics
Handguards*
Muzzle devices [suppressors, flash hiders, muzzle breaks]
Pistol Grip
Ambi safety selector

There are some items will NOT work, however, there are after market alternatives designed specifically for the 15-22:

Charging Handle
Bolt Catch/Release Lever
Anti-walk hammer/trigger pins

Then there are things for which there are no 'direct' alternatives/replacements:
Folding Stock (note - some people have cut off the existing buffer tube and then, through various fabrication, installed a LAW Folding Stock)
Barrel
Upper Receiver
Lower Receiver
Barrel Nut


*Note, to swap out the handguard, you need a special barrel nut converter, sold by Tacticool. Also, if you want to remove the barrel (for cleaning or swapping out the handguard), CLAMP THE BARREL, not the upper receiver. There is a specific tool (you can purchase or make) that will allow you to loosen or tighten the 15-22 barrel nut.

One thing nobody mentioned, is his buttstock pinned? If it is you need to remove the pin before you are able to remove the buttstock. Just thought i would mention that.
